LCG, November 26, 2025--RWE announced today the commissioning of the Stoneridge Solar project, located in Milam County, Texas. The project capacity is 200 MW of solar power, plus a battery energy storage system (BESS) that provides 100 MW (200 MWh) of battery storage capacity. The BESS improves the supply of short-term, reliable, affordable electricity in ERCOT.

LCG, November 19, 2025--Oklo Inc. and Siemens Energy announced today that the parties have signed a binding contract for the design and delivery of the power conversion system for Oklo’s Aurora-INL (Idaho National Laboratory) nuclear small modular reactor (SMR). The agreement authorizes Siemens Energy to begin engineering and design work to expedite procurement of long-lead components and to initiate the manufacturing process for the power conversion system. Oklo’s expertise in advanced fission technology will be combined with Siemens Energy’s extensive industry experience with steam turbine and generator systems, with the ultimate goal of generating carbon-free, reliable electricity.

Calpine Begins Building 115 Megawatt Florida Peaker
LCG, Aug. 3, 2001--Calpine Corp said yesterday it has begun construction on a 115 megawatt simple-cycle peaking unit located at its existing Auburndale Energy Center located in central Florida, east of Tampa.Calpine said in a news release "the $40 million facility is expected to be in commercial operations in time to help meet peak summer demands in the fast-growing Florida power market during the summer of 2002.""This new peaking unit will complement and enhance our existing 150 megawatt cogenerationfacility and our proposed Osprey Energy Center, which will be located right next door," said Bob Alff, Calpine senior vice president and head of its eastern region.In addition to the Auburndale Energy Center, Calpine recently received state regulatory approval for its proposed 529 megawatt Osprey Energy Center, becoming the first independent power producer to receive approval in Florida for a large-scale combined-cycle generating facility.The Osprey project is scheduled to begin construction later this year, with commercial operations expected during the summer of 2003. "Auburndale is an ideal location for power generation," Alff said. "This is an exciting next step in our overall Florida development strategy."Calpine is also in the process of developing the 1,080 megawatt Blue Heron Energy Center, to be located in Indian River County, near Vero Beach.
